Why These Are the Top Walk-in Tubs Contractors in Johnson City

** The walk-in tub and accessible bathroom market in Johnson City is served by a mix of strong national franchise providers and established local remodeling contractors. The competition is healthy but not oversaturated, ensuring a good standard of quality and service. The national providers (like Bath Fitter and Re-Bath) offer the advantages of branded product lines, standardized processes, and often faster installation times. Local contractors like Binghamton Kitchen & Bath offer more personalized, custom solutions but may have longer project timelines. Typical pricing for a complete walk-in tub installation in the Johnson City area can range from **$5,000 to $15,000+**. The final cost is highly dependent on the tub's features (e.g., basic soaker tub vs. advanced hydrotherapy), the extent of plumbing and electrical work required, and whether the project is a simple tub replacement or a full bathroom remodel to improve accessibility. Consumers are advised to obtain multiple in-home consultations and detailed quotes that include all labor, materials, and product warranties.

Frequently Asked Questions About Walk-in Tubs in Johnson City

Get answers to common questions about walk-in tubs services in Johnson City, New York.

1What is the typical cost range for a walk-in tub installation in Johnson City, and are there any local factors that affect the price?

In Johnson City, a complete walk-in tub installation typically ranges from $5,000 to $15,000+, depending on the tub model, features, and necessary bathroom modifications. Local factors that can influence cost include the age of your home's plumbing (older homes may need updates), potential challenges with narrow stairwells in local housing stock for tub delivery, and the need for a dedicated 20-amp GFCI electrical circuit per New York State code. Always get a detailed, in-home estimate from a local provider.

2How long does a full walk-in tub installation take for a Johnson City homeowner, and should I consider the season when scheduling?

From order to completion, a standard installation typically takes 4 to 8 weeks, with the actual installation work lasting 1 to 3 days. Considering Johnson City's cold, snowy winters is wise; scheduling installations for spring or fall can avoid delays in tub delivery via truck and allows for better ventilation if windows need to be opened during work. It also ensures local contractors are not overbooked with emergency winter repair calls.

3Are there specific permits or regulations for walk-in tub installations in Johnson City, NY?

Yes, a plumbing permit from the Village of Johnson City Building Department is generally required for installation, as it involves modifying water supply and drain lines. The work must comply with New York State Uniform Fire Prevention and Building Code, including specific electrical requirements for pumps and heaters. A reputable local installer will handle the permit process, which is a key reason to choose a licensed, insured professional familiar with local codes.

4What should I look for when choosing a walk-in tub service provider in the Johnson City area?

Prioritize providers licensed, insured, and physically based in the Southern Tier or Greater Binghamton area for reliable local service. Check for strong references within Johnson City and Broome County, and verify they perform in-home assessments (not just phone quotes). Given the region's hard water, ask about their experience with tub models featuring easy-to-clean jet systems and their post-installation service response time for maintenance.

5I'm concerned about slipping and the tub retaining heat in our cold climate. What features are most important for Johnson City winters?

For safety, prioritize a tub with a low, step-in threshold (2 inches or less) and a built-in, textured floor surface. For heat retention, look for models with full foam insulation in the tub walls and a high-quality door seal. Given our long heating season, a rapid-fill faucet and an in-line heater are valuable features to maintain comfortable water temperature throughout your bath, combating heat loss common in colder home environments.
